Is black sewing first, sewing closest to the brim?

To deal with difficult caps:

Slow machine speed
Start design slightly off center
Move start of design away from brim
Use 80/12 needle


If you're running a single head and have extra room between the hat and the frame you can use a tweezer to hold down hat material to get starter without breaking a needle.
